How to Find a Private Psychiatrist in the UK
Finding the best mental health care expert can be an overwhelming job, particularly when thinking about private psychiatry. The UK uses a diverse range of mental health services, however numerous people looking for treatment frequently choose the customized approach that private psychiatrists supply. This post will assist you through the actions required to find a private psychiatrist in the UK, what elements to consider, and answers to regularly asked concerns.
Comprehending Private Psychiatry
Private psychiatry refers to mental healthcare services supplied by specialists who operate outside the National Health Service (NHS). Clients who pick private psychiatry typically seek quicker access to appointments, a broader choice of professionals, and various treatment options that might not be offered through civil services.
Benefits of Private PsychiatryReduced Waiting Times: Patients typically experience significantly shorter wait times for visits.Versatile Scheduling: Appointment times can be more accommodating to the client's requirements.Personalized Care: Patients may have more chances for individually time with their psychiatrist.Access to Specialists: Availability of a wider range of specialties and treatment techniques.Actions to Find a Private Psychiatrist
The procedure of discovering a private psychiatrist involves several essential actions. The following guide details these steps in information:
1. Identify Your Needs
Before you begin looking for a psychiatrist, it's crucial to comprehend what you require. Consider the following:
Type of Therapy Needed: Are you looking for medication management, psychotherapy, or both?Specialization: Some psychiatrists specialize in specific areas, such as anxiety disorders, anxiety, ADHD, or injury.Preferred Treatment Methods: Some specialists might integrate alternative therapies or choose evidence-based medicine, so it's necessary to know what you're looking for.2. Research Potential Psychiatrists
Conduct extensive research to assemble a list of potential psychiatrists. Here are some resources to consider:
Online Directories: Websites like the Royal College of Psychiatrists, Therapy Directory, or Psychology Today can supply listings of qualified psychiatrists in your area.Word of Mouth: Recommendations from household, good friends, or other healthcare professionals can lead you to credible psychiatrists.Insurance Providers: If you have private medical insurance, check which psychiatrists are covered under your strategy.3. Examine Qualifications and Experience
When you have a list, it's important to verify each prospect's certifications. Look for:
Medical Qualifications: Ensure that the psychiatrist is registered with the General Medical Council (GMC) and is a member of an expert body, such as the Royal College of Psychiatrists.Experience: Review their experience in treating your particular condition.Client Reviews: Online reviews or reviews can supply extra insights into the psychiatrist's approach and effectiveness.4. How do I understand if I need to see a psychiatrist?
If you are experiencing persistent signs impacting your everyday life, such as serious mood swings, anxiety, anxiety, or changes in behavior, it may be time to consider speaking with a psychiatrist.
2. Can I self-refer to a private psychiatrist?
Yes, individuals can self-refer to private psychiatrists without needing a referral from a GP, which is frequently needed for NHS services.
3. Will my insurance coverage cover the expenses of a private psychiatrist?
Numerous private medical insurance plans deal coverage for expert psychiatric services, but it's vital to inspect your specific policy details.
4. What can I anticipate during my very first consultation?
During the very first consultation, you can anticipate to discuss your symptoms, individual history, treatment objectives, and any concerns you might have regarding the treatment process.
5. The length of time will I require to see a psychiatrist?
The duration of treatment varies widely depending upon the person's needs and the complexity of their condition. Regular continuous assessments will assist figure out the continued necessity of sessions.
